Mirror and Water Images is an important topic under the subject of General Intelligence / Reasoning Ability. It evaluates a candidate’s ability to visualize and interpret reflections of objects, letters, numbers, or figures when placed before a mirror or reflected in water. This topic is frequently asked in competitive exams and government job exams to test observation skills, spatial visualization, and logical reasoning ability.
Key concepts include left–right reversal in mirror images, top–bottom inversion in water images, recognition of symmetrical figures, and understanding how letters, numbers, and symbols appear after reflection. Candidates must carefully analyze orientation changes and apply visual logic to identify the correct reflected image.
